Summary

From award-winning comedian and bestselling author Stewart Lee, his first original book in fifteen years—a brilliantly dark comedic retelling of Edward Lear’s The Owl and the Pussycat—and the tragic ‘true’ story behind it.

About The Author

Stewart Lee

Stewart Lee (Author)

Stewart Lee began performing stand-up in 1988 and won the Hackney Empire New Act of the Year in 1990. He co-wrote the libretto for Jerry Springer – The Opera, which won four Olivier Awards, and is known for his BAFTA-winning BBC series Stewart Lee’s Comedy Vehicle. His major live shows include Carpet Remnant World, Much A Stew About Nothing, Snowflake/Tornado, and Stewart Lee vs The Man-Wulf.

He is also the bestselling author of How I Escaped My Certain Fate, Content Provider, and March of the Lemmings.

David Waywell (Illustrator)

David Waywell is a writer and illustrator based in the North West. He holds a PhD in Romantic Literature from the University of Liverpool and is the author of The Secret Lives of Monks and Second-Class Male (written as Stan Madeley).
